What is a Mobile Car Locksmith?
A mobile car locksmith is an extremely knowledgeable expert who concentrates on supplying automotive locksmith services on the go. Unlike traditional store locksmiths, these professionals run out of equipped vans or mobile units, enabling them to react to emergency situations wherever you are-- be it your driveway, a shopping mall car park, or by the side of the roadway. They're trained in managing numerous car lock issues and frequently operate 24/7 to ensure rapid support throughout emergencies.
Why You Might Need a Mobile Car Locksmith
Car lock and key emergencies can occur to anybody. Here are some common circumstances where a mobile car locksmith can conserve the day:
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Misplacing or losing your car keys can happen to anybody. Worse yet, if your keys have been stolen, a mobile locksmith can rapidly rekey or replace your locks, ensuring your vehicle is safe and secure once again.
Car Lockouts
Unintentionally locking your keys inside your vehicle is one of the most typical reasons people call locksmiths. Mobile locksmiths can safely open your car without causing damage.
Broken or Damaged Keys
Keys can break inside locks or ignitions with time due to use and tear. A mobile locksmith can extract the broken key and provide a replacement on the area.
Damaged Car Locks or Ignition Switches
Whether due to vandalism, a tried theft, or normal wear and tear, damaged locks or ignition systems can prevent you from starting your vehicle. A mobile car locksmith can repair or replace these components.
Transponder Key Programming
Modern vehicles frequently utilize key fobs with transponder chips. If your transponder is malfunctioning or requires reprogramming, a mobile locksmith can assist with the required technology.

When browsing for a "mobile car locksmith near me," it's vital to guarantee you're hiring a dependable and competent professional. Here are some pointers to assist you discover the right professional:
Check Credentials
Guarantee the locksmith is licensed, bonded, and insured. These credentials demonstrate professionalism and responsibility.
Read Reviews and Ratings
Look for consumer evaluations on platforms like Google, Yelp, or the Better Business Bureau. Favorable reviews suggest client complete satisfaction and dependability.
Ask about Pricing
Ask for a quote upfront to prevent any concealed fees. While some locksmith professionals provide price varieties over the phone, make certain there are no surprises after the task is done.
Ask About Experience
Validate that the locksmith has experience dealing with your car make and model. Some professionals specialize in specific vehicles or lock systems.
Availability
In emergency situations, schedule is key. Guarantee the locksmith provides 24/7 services and has a quick action time.
Validate Identification
A trustworthy locksmith will supply recognition upon arrival. Additionally, they might ask for proof of ownership of the vehicle to avoid unapproved access.
Frequently Asked Questions about Mobile Car Locksmiths
Here are some often asked concerns about mobile car locksmith services:
Q: How quickly can a mobile car locksmith reach me?A: Response times may vary based upon your place and the locksmith's current workload, however a lot of mobile locksmiths aim to get here within 15-- 30 minutes in emergency situation scenarios. Q: Can a mobile locksmith make a key without the original?A: Yes, they can cut and program a replacement key from scratch using your vehicle's recognition number(VIN) or by translating the car's lock. Q: Will a mobile locksmith damage my car while unlocking it?A: No, expert mobile locksmiths utilize specialized tools to unlock vehicles without leaving any damage. Q: Do mobile locksmith professionals deal with all car brands and models?A: Most mobile locksmiths are experienced in working with a wide range of typical car brands and designs, including both domestic and global
automobiles. Always validate their expertise when calling. Q: How much does it cost to work with a mobile car locksmith?A: Costs differ based upon the type of service needed, area, and complexity. A basic car lockout might v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150
, while key replacements or ignition repairs might cost more.
